PHOTO GALLERY: Norev Porsche 911 (964) Turbo 3.6

The Porsche 911 (964) Turbo 3.6, produced only for the 1993–1994 model years, represents one of the rarest and most coveted air‑cooled Turbos ever built. Porsche replaced the earlier 3.3-litre unit with the new 3.6‑litre M64/50 engine, paired with a KKK K27 turbocharger and delivering 360 hp at 5,500 rpm—a substantial leap in both power and drivability. Breaking News: Martisan Limits Production Ferrari 250 LM

Martisan has issued an important update today — one that brings both urgency and exclusivity to collectors worldwide. Due to the extremely complex manufacturing process, production of the Ferrari 250 LM in 1:18 scale will be limited strictly to orders placed by March 26th. PHOTO GALLERY: Motorhelix Alfa Romeo Giulia GTAm Tricolore

Coinciding with the Olympics in Northern Italy´s city of Milan (where Alfa Romeo was founded), Motorhelix have released a third version of their Alfa Romeo Giulia. This time it´s a red GTAm bearing a sportive Italian tricolore stripe, white bumpers and door roundels with a #69 commemorating some of their successful 1970s racing Giulias. ACME 1970 Oldsmobile 442 W30 – W Machine | Drag Outlaws

ACME, under their Drag Outlaws series, has unveiled the painted sample 1:18 diecast metal and opening 1970 Oldsmobile 442 W30 – W Machine replica.  This model is scheduled to arrive in late Q2 2026.  The suggested retail $144.95 US. KiloWorks DarwinPRO Audi RS6 – Red DPR Wheel Hub Version

KiloWorks is back with another exterior/wheel option for their 1:18 diecast metal and opening DarwinPRO Audi RS6.  This example is defined as Red DPR Wheel Hub Version.  Production is capped at 199 units and should be on shelves later next month!  One will set you back about $279 CND.
